WebJul 5, 2024 · Booting Into Safe Mode. To reboot into safe mode on Android 4.1 or later, long-press the power button until the power options menu appears. Long-press the Power Off option and you’ll be asked if you want to reboot your Android device into safe mode. Tap the OK button. WebDec 16, 2024 · To boot into Safe Mode on Windows 10, Shift-click "Restart" in the Start menu or the sign-in screen, then navigate to Troubleshoot > Advanced Options > Startup Settings and restart your PC.
